protected void doGet(HttpServletRequest request, HttpServletResponse response)
     throws ServletException, IOException {
   HttpSession session = request.getSession(false);
   if (session == null || session.getAttribute("klant") == null) {
     response.sendRedirect(String.format(LOGIN_REDIRECT, request.getContextPath()));
   } else {
     Klant klant = klantService.read(((Klant) session.getAttribute("klant")).getId());
     if (klant != null) {
       Set<InterfaceLijn> oud = new TreeSet<>();
       Set<InterfaceLijn> huidig = new TreeSet<>();
       for (InterfaceLijn lijn : klant.getReservaties()) {
         if (lijn.getOpvoering().getDatum().before(Calendar.getInstance().getTime())) {
           oud.add(lijn);
         } else {
           huidig.add(lijn);
         }
       }
       if (!oud.isEmpty()) {
         request.setAttribute("oud", oud);
       }
       if (!huidig.isEmpty()) {
         request.setAttribute("huidig", huidig);
       }
       session.setAttribute("klant", klant);
       request.getRequestDispatcher(VIEW).forward(request, response);
     }
   }
 }